>> On Oct 28, 2008, at 5:57 PM, Jake Anderson wrote:
>>
>> > I have seen this issue.
>> > It was related to openGL as I recall.
>> > try using the arrow keys to move around a bit that will probably get
>> > the intro menu back.
>> > go into the setup menu and turn all the openGL stuff off.
>> > there *might* be something in mythtv-setup to do the same as well
>> > but i forget now.
>>
>> Launch with mythfrontend --O ThemePainter=qt to temporarily use QT
>> instead of OpenGL.
>>
>> Although, I would recommend fixing the OpenGL issues, of course.
